What has Warner's Ashes series 18 months got to do with anything? This is David Warner at home, who is an entirely different proposition. He is an easy target because of his record in England, but his record at home is not up for dispute.


He only had 2 innings against Pakistan and made 489 runs.

You are forgetting he averaged 60 against NZ prior to the Pakistan games and was the second highest run scorer of that series behind Labuschagne.

His series at home prior to that was the 17/18 Ashes in which he averaged 63.

His series at home prior to that was against Pakistan where he averaged 71.


We are talking about one of the greatest batsman of all time in Australian conditions here. He averages 66 from 40+ test matches at home at a SR of 75 facing the new ball. Hayden's (who is widely considered a huge flat track bully in the Sehwag mould) record in Australia doesn't even come close to Warners.

How far back do you want to go?


Warner has only had 2 series on Australian soil where he's averaged less than 55 in his entire career, both against South Africa (2012 & 2016).

An unbelievable statistic.
